/**
* Background View: Draw 4 full-screen RGBY triangles
*/
public class BackgroundView extends View {
private int[] mColors = new int[4];
private final short[] mIndices =
{ 0, 1, 2, 0, 3, 4, 0, 1, 4 // Corner points for triangles (with offset = 2)
};
private float[] mVertexPoints = null;
public BackgroundView(Context context, AttributeSet attrs) {
super(context, attrs);
setFocusable(true);
// retrieve colors for 4 segments from styleable properties
TypedArray a = context.obtainStyledAttributes(attrs, R.styleable.BackgroundView);
mColors[0] = a.getColor(R.styleable.BackgroundView_colorSegmentOne, Color.RED);
mColors[1] = a.getColor(R.styleable.BackgroundView_colorSegmentTwo, Color.YELLOW);
mColors[2] = a.getColor(R.styleable.BackgroundView_colorSegmentThree, Color.BLUE);
mColors[3] = a.getColor(R.styleable.BackgroundView_colorSegmentFour, Color.GREEN);
a.recycle();
}
@Override
protected void onDraw(Canvas canvas) {
assert(mVertexPoints != null);
// Colors for each vertex
int[] mFillColors = new int[mVertexPoints.length];
for (int triangle = 0; triangle < mColors.length; triangle++) {
// Set color for all vertex points to current triangle color
Arrays.fill(mFillColors, mColors[triangle]);
// Draw one triangle
canvas.drawVertices(Canvas.VertexMode.TRIANGLES, mVertexPoints.length, mVertexPoints,
0, null, 0, // No Textures
mFillColors, 0, mIndices,
triangle * 2, 3, // Use 3 vertices via Index Array with offset 2
new Paint());
}
}
@Override
protected void onSizeChanged(int w, int h, int oldw, int oldh) {
super.onSizeChanged(w, h, oldw, oldh);
// Construct our center and four corners
mVertexPoints = new float[] {
w / 2, h / 2,
0, 0,
w, 0,
w, h,
0, h
};
}
}
